Profileimage by Anonymous profile, Software-Entwickler
available

Last update: 16.03.2023

Software-Entwickler

Graduation: M. Sc. Bioinformatik
Hourly-/Daily rates: show
Languages: German (Native or Bilingual) | English (Full Professional)

Keywords

Skills

Programmiersprachen:
  • C#
  • MATLAB
  • Solidity


Technologien:
  • .NET
  • WPF
  • MEF
  • WinForms
  • MATLAB Coder
  • MATLAB Compiler
  • CERA
  • Volume Graphic
  • XML
  • REST
  • TCP / IP
  • COM- und LPT-Schnittstellen
  • Blockchain & Smart Contracts
  • .NET
  • WPF
  • MEF
  • WinForms
  • MATLAB Coder
  • MATLAB Compiler
  • CERA
  • Volume Graphic
  • XML
  • REST
  • TCP / IP
  • COM- und LPT-Schnittstellen
  • Blockchain & Smart Contracts

Project history

03/2022 - 11/2022
Software-Entwickler
Visiconsult

Refactoring und Weiterentwicklung einer bestehenden Software-Lösung zur Steuerung und Auswertung von Aufnahmen im Bereich Computertomographie (CT).  

Dazu gehörte zunächst die Analyse der vorhandenen Codebase, die Restrukturierung mit dem Ziel größerer Robustheit und das Beheben verschiedener Bugs. Im Weiteren Verlauf wurden von mir eine Reihe neuer Funktionalitäten in die bestehende Software eingebaut, teilweise in Form von Plug-Ins, die mit Hilfe des Managed Extensibility Frameworks (MEF) integriert wurden.

Teilweise wurden dafür bestehende Prototypen auf MATLAB-Basis von mir in C# umgesetzt.


02/2020 - 10/2021
Software-Entwickler
Maschinenbau (IDE)

Entwicklung einer Optimierungssoftware mit Grafikoberfläche (GUI) für das Tunen von Schwingungstischen. Die Software wurde mit C#.NET entwickelt, für die GUI wurde WPF verwendet. Die Algorithmik basiert auf einem bereits vorhandenen MATLAB-Skript, welches mit Hilfe des MATLAB Compilers in die C#.NET Software eingebunden wurde.

Zu meinen Aufgaben gehörte die Entwicklung der eigenständigen Software mit C#.NET, das Erstellen der Grafikoberfläche, sowie das Identifizieren und Umsetzen nötiger Anpassungen am vorhandenen MATLAB-Skript, um eine Einbindung in .NET mit Hilfe des MATLAB Compilers zu erlauben.

02/2017 - 11/2020
Software-Entwickler
FinTech

Entwicklung eines Trading-Bots zum automatisierten Handel an der Kryptowährungsbörse Bitfinex. Die Kommunikation der Software mit Bitfinex fand über die REST-API der Börse statt.

Außerdem die Entwicklung, Optimierung und Implementierung mehrerer Trading-Algorithmen, welche auf Basis der Kursentwicklung und vorgegebener Kriterien automatisiert Transaktionen auf Bitfinex durchführen. Der automatisierte Handel kann dabei dynamisch vom Benutzer über ein User-Interface
angepasst werden.

06/2018 - 02/2020
Netzwerkadministrator
Sozialer Träger (Frankfurter Verein)

Unterstützung bei der Netzwerkadminsitration für einen sozialen Träger in Frankfurt am Main, für den ich bereits zuvor (2013 - 2015) an einem Projekt gearbeitet habe. Der Verein besitzt über 60 Einrichtungen im gesamten Großraum Frankfurt am Main, aber nur eine einzige IT-Abteilung in der Zentrale. Meine Zuständigkeit war die Pflege der Netzwerkadministration vor Ort in den verschiedenen Einrichtungen. Übliche Aufgaben waren die Bearbeitung von Tickets, das Identifizieren von Problemen vor Ort, Lösung von Problemen in Eigenregie, andernfalls Rücksprache mit der Zentrale und Schilderung der Situation, Vermittlung mit Mitarbeitern vor Ort, etc.

08/2015 - 08/2016
Software-Entwickler
Biotechnologie

Entwicklung eines Algorithmus, der regulatorische Pathways aus Zeitreihen-Transkriptdaten und Zeitreihen-Metabolitkonzentrationen ableitet. Dabei wurde eine ausführliche Literaturrecherche im Bereich des Reverse Engineering von Modellen durchgeführt, und ein neuer Algorithmus auf Basis von
Regressionsbäumen entworfen.

Der Algorithmus wurde in MATLAB implementiert und mit diesem Prototyp anhand von experimentellen und simulierten Messdaten das Verfahren evaluiert. Zur Analyse der Ergebnisse wurden verschiedene statistische Verfahren automatisiert angewandt.

09/2013 - 01/2015
Software-Entwickler
Forschungsinstitut (Brain Imaging Center Frankfurt am Main)

Die entwickelte Software wird verwendet, um Probanden während der Experimente dynamisch modifizierbares visuelles Feedback bei der Ausübung verschiedener sensorimotorischer Aufgabenstellungen zu geben. Der Proband kann in Echtzeit über Drucksensoren mit dem Programm interagieren. Gleichzeitig überwacht die Software die Prozessierung der durch MRT, MEG oder EEG aufgenommenen Daten. Für die Realisierung wurde das .NET-Framework gewählt. Die GUI wurde mit
WinForms und WPF verwirklicht.

10/2012 - 10/2013
Software-Entwickler, Web-Entwickler
Architekturbüro (Braun Canton Architekten GmbH)

Technisches Design und Implementierung eines selbstenwickelten Content Management Systems (CMS) für die eigene Website des Kunden. Das Frontend sollte auf Wunsch des Kunden ausschließlich auf Basis von Adobe Flash entwickelt werden, nachdem hier bereits ein umgesetztes Design ohne nennenswerte
programmiertechnische Dynamik bestand. Für die Umsetzung des Backends wurde eine Lösung auf PHP-Basis umgesetzt. Zum Speichern der Daten
wurde XML verwendet.

02/2012 - 12/2012
Software-Entwickler
Max-Planck-Institut für Dynamik komplexer technischer Systeme

Entwicklung der GUI-gesteuerten Matlab-Toolbox 'LiNA' zur Automatisierung der 'Linear Noise Approximation' und zur einfachen grafischen Aufarbeitung der Ergebnisse. Die Benutzeroberfläche bietet eine einfache Bedienbarkeit bei der Analyse verschiedener statistischer Kennwerte in Abhängigkeit der kinetischen Parameter des biochemischen Netzwerks. Eine detaillierte Beschreibung und das Programm selbst finden sich unter: http://www2.mpi-magdeburg.mpg.de/projects/LiNA

Local Availability

Only available for remote work
Hohe Reisebereitschaft
Profileimage by Anonymous profile, Software-Entwickler Software-Entwickler
Register